Hi.

I found THIS while searching the web for ram.

Is that the right kind of ram for the 17" PB? I'm a little insecure, because the webpage reads Apple Titanium 1GHz... But it also reads PC2700. Anyone knows?

Thanks.

The Titanium PowerBook doesn't use DDR-RAM. Why don't you email them since it could very well be either a typo error with the RAM type or the PowerBook model? My guess is they've got the PowerBook model wrong; probably just duplicated their database entry or something.

Yeah, definitely email them before ordering, as that is conflicting material. Also, www.ramseeker.com and www.18004memory.com have always been reliable places to get PowerBook RAM at great prices.

And to answer the secondary question, no one on these boards have tried the 1GIG RAM modules in the 17" PB as far as I know...most will wait until the price drops because with RAM passing 1GIG, the law of diminishing returns really begins to take effect, and the tiny performance gains just aren't worth it.
